心情说说精选,经典句子大全,个性签名大全-北井心情网

心情说说精选,经典句子大全,个性签名大全-北井心情网

学习树莓派需要学习什么

59

学习树莓派需要掌握以下几种编程语言和技术:

Python:

树莓派最常用的编程语言是Python。Python是一种易学易用的脚本语言,可以用于编写各种应用程序和脚本。对于初学者来说,Python是一个很好的入门选择。你可以学习基本的语法和控制结构,然后深入了解如何使用Python与树莓派的GPIO(通用输入输出)接口进行交互。

Linux命令行:

树莓派的操作系统是基于Linux的,因此你需要了解一些基本的Linux命令行操作。这包括文件和目录管理、进程管理、权限管理等。熟悉Linux命令行可以帮助你更好地操作树莓派的系统。

C/C++:

虽然使用Python可以完成大多数树莓派的编程任务,但如果你想在底层进行更高级的编程或者进行更复杂的项目开发,那么学习C/C++也是很有帮助的。C/C++可以让你更深入地了解树莓派的硬件和底层操作。

Web开发:

如果你想将树莓派用于构建Web应用程序,那么学习一些Web开发技术也是必要的。这包括HTML、CSS、JavaScript和后端框架(如Django或Flask)。通过学习这些技术,你可以创建交互式的Web界面,控制树莓派并显示传感器数据等。

数据库:

在一些项目中,你可能需要使用数据库来存储和管理数据。学习数据库技术(如MySQL或SQLite)可以帮助你更好地组织和查询数据。

物联网(IoT)技术:

树莓派是一个非常适合物联网项目的平台。学习物联网相关的技术可以帮助你在树莓派上构建智能家居、远程监控系统、环境传感器等。

Shell脚本编程:

Shell脚本是在Linux环境下进行自动化任务的重要工具。通过学习Shell脚本编程,可以编写各种自动化脚本,提高工作效率。

微机原理与接口技术:

如果你要用树莓派玩硬件,那么你至少需要了解微机原理与接口技术。

恒心:

学习树莓派编程需要一定的耐心和恒心,通过不断的实践和学习,你将能够熟练地使用树莓派进行编程并实现各种项目。

其他编程语言:

根据你的项目需求,你可能还需要学习其他编程语言,如Java、JavaScript等,以及相关的开发工具和框架。

通过学习这些知识和技术,你将能够在树莓派上实现各种有趣的项目和应用。建议结合在线教程、书籍、视频课程和项目实践来学习,这样可以更加深入地理解和掌握树莓派的编程技能。